Need help making a skintone showerproof
Campingstove:
I downloaded a sim from another site with a slim bb body shape. He has a really pretty tattooed skintone, but it is not showerproof. I've had him in my game for about a month now, but the floating head thing is making me crazy.
I can't get any response from the creator...so I tried using Marvine's tutorial to make it showerproof and just can't seem to follow it. I am rather incompetent with Simpe, and something always goes wrong about halfway through the tutorial and I can't find any of the right files.
I am hoping there might be a newer tutorial somewhere, or something that might help explain the steps so I can figure out where I go wrong.
Or is it possible for someone to make it showerproof for me? It is only for my personal use, but obviously I don't have permission from the creator, as I can't get a response from them...so I am probably out of luck on that front.
Any help or advice would be greatly appreciated!

aerykbacon:
You could try:
Downloading a skintone that is showeproof for the slim bb.
Open bodyshop.
Extract the textures for the skin you want to use.
Extract the textures for the skin that is showerproof.
Overwrite the textures for the skin that is showerproof, with the skin textures that you want to use.
Import back in bodyshop, and viola!
That's all you have to do if the meshes are already linked to a skintone.

aerykbacon:
No! It doesn't overwrite! It creates a new skintone, if you do it through bodyshop!
It's the same as recoloring an outfit! 3yay
When you export say a skirt, it creates a new package linked to the same mesh of the skirt, and exports the current textures of the skirt as bmps in your "my projects" folder. You can edit or do anything with them. Then you go into bodyshop, and press "import to game" the textures will be imported to the package. It will be a new recolor, and it wont overwrite the maxis orginal, because it creates a new guid for you.
It will work the same way with the skin. Get a skin, that's base meshes are the bb nudes. Export it in bodyshop. Then when it's done, close that project for a moment. Start a New Project. Now export the skin with the tatoo. Now you should have two folders within your "My Projects" folder. Go into the folder with the skin of the tatoo, and select all the bmps in there. Then paste them into the folder, of the other one. Let them overwrite. Now go back into bodyshop, and close the current project. Now "load saved project" and load the first one. The one that you exported that was originally linked to the Bodybuilder skin. Next, select "import to game". Bodyshop will then import the textures of the tatoo, instead of the originals, into the new recolor of the skin.
